Bret “Hitman” Hart Reveals He Has Prostate Cancer

Hall of Fame wrestler Bret “Hitman” Hart revealed that he has prostate cancer in an Instagram post shared on Monday.

Hart retired after suffering a concussion in 1999, he won the WWF world heavyweight title five times during his career and he also won two world heavyweight titles with the WCW to go along with an additional five US heavyweight titles in the WWE. Hart also suffered a stroke in 2002 but he vows he will fight this battle with all he’s got. “I make a solemn vow to all of those that once believed in me, the dead and the living, that I will wage my fearsome fight against cancer with one shield and one sword carrying my determination and my fury for life, emboldened by all the love that’s kept me going this long already.” Triple H and Chris Jericho reacted on social media:
